Category 1: Local Lead Generation & Trade Routing (High-Ticket B2B)
Local service businesses need paying clients, and local homeowners search Google daily for help. You build the digital asset that connects them:
1. Commercial Snow Removal Lead Hub: Build a regional portal in Ontario connecting commercial property managers with insured plowing contractors before winter. 2. Emergency Tree Removal Directory: Capture urgent storm damage searches and route emergency quote requests to certified local arborists for a flat per-lead fee. 3. Epoxy Flooring & Garage Transformation Portal: Showcase residential and commercial flooring options with an interactive instant quote estimator, forwarding leads to local installers. 4. Basement Waterproofing & Foundation Repair Hub: High-ticket repairs (a project-specific amount) where contractors gladly pay a project-specific amount for every qualified on-site estimate request. 5. Specialized Commercial Cleaning Connector: Target medical offices, dental clinics, and corporate facilities looking for bonded janitorial contracts.
Category 2: Niche Business Directories & Resource Portals (Recurring Subscriptions)
Create curated, searchable directories for specific industries and charge for verified listings and premium visibility:
6. Local Pet Care & Dog Boarding Directory: A clean directory listing licensed kennels, mobile groomers, and certified trainers with customer reviews. 7. Wedding Vendor & Venue Aggregator: Help couples find independent, local venues, caterers, and photographers, charging vendors a project-specific amountnth for featured placement. 8. Commercial Equipment Rental Directory: Connect contractors with local suppliers renting heavy machinery, scissor lifts, and generators. 9. Private Health Clinic & Wellness Directory: List independent physiotherapists, chiropractors, and massage therapists with direct booking links. 10.B2B Industrial Supplier Guide: A regional directory of machine shops, metal fabricators, and packaging suppliers for Canadian manufacturers.
Category 3: Productized Freelance & Agency Services (Predictable Retainers)
Take a single professional skill, strip away custom agency complexity, and sell it as a fixed-scope product:
11.Google Business Profile Optimization Service: Charge local trades a flat a project-specific amount fee to fully optimize and verify their Google Map listings. 12.Monthly Website Maintenance & Security Care: Charge small businesses a project-specific amountnth to handle cloud backups, plugin updates, uptime monitoring, and security patching. 13.Local SEO Content Retainer: Provide four high-authority, localized service articles per month for contractors looking to rank in nearby suburbs. 14.Database & Webhook Automation Setup: Build custom synchronization workflows between Airtable, CRM platforms, and Stripe for small e-commerce stores. 15.Landing Page Design for Paid Ad Campaigns: Build fast, high-converting standalone landing pages for companies running Google Ads.
Category 4: Free Interactive Web Calculators & Utilities (Massive Organic Traffic)
Simple web tools generate massive recurring search traffic that converts into consulting, sponsorships, or software subscriptions:
16.Contractor Material & Tonnage Calculator: A free tool for pavers and landscapers calculating gravel, topsoil, and asphalt cubic yards. 17.Canadian Land Transfer Tax Calculator: A fast, municipal-level calculator for real estate buyers in Ontario, monetized through mortgage broker referral partnerships. 18.Freelance Hourly Rate & Expense Calculator: Helps solo practitioners calculate their true break-even rate based on taxes, vacation, and overhead. 19.Commercial Lease Square-Footage Estimator: Helps retail and office tenants estimate total monthly occupancy costs, including TMI (Taxes, Maintenance, Insurance). 20.Barcode & Nutrition Lookup Tool: A lightweight mobile web tool scanning consumer packaging to display clean ingredient breakdowns.
Category 5: Specialized Comparison & Curation Portals (Affiliate & Sponsorships)
Help buyers make complex purchasing decisions by providing transparent, practitioner-level breakdowns:
21.Business Banking & Merchant Account Comparison: Compare fees, transaction limits, and POS hardware for Canadian small retailers. 22.Point-of-Sale (POS) Software Guide for Restaurants: Independent teardowns of restaurant ordering software, monetized via high-paying partner programs. 23.Commercial Insurance Buyer’s Guide: Educate trade contractors on general liability, tools coverage, and commercial auto policies, routing inquiries to licensed brokers. 24.CRM Software for Service Contractors: Teardowns comparing platforms like Jobber, ServiceTitan, and GoHighLevel for trades businesses. 25.Remote Team Hardware & Ergonomic Setup Guide: Review commercial standing desks, monitors, and ergonomic gear, earning affiliate commissions on corporate orders.
The 3 Rules of High-Margin Digital Assets
Every business model listed above adheres to three core economic principles:
- Rule 1: Zero Physical Inventory: You never buy stock upfront, pay warehouse storage fees, or deal with broken shipments.
- Rule 2: Asymmetric commercially viable Margins: Operating costs consist of domain registration via registries like the Canadian Internet Registration Authority (CIRA) and cloud hosting—keeping commercially viable margins above a project-specific percentage.
- Rule 3: Search-Driven Acquisition: You rely on organic search demand adhering to Google Search Central Guidelines, rather than burning cash on volatile social media ads.
